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 11704 05519929907
368413826 6976922 2098308
368413826 6976922 2098308
1404 277 7290419 54 8397596235
All about undefined
Interested in learning more?
368413826 6976922 2098308
1404 277 7290419 54 8397596235
See more
6633 060531 98593075544
6373 0908 8330292
See more
720647 38349648734
34517797710 1608 8318080 41568
See more